.. . YAY!! What was it? What did you to do fix it? Natural Balance Duck and potato food. I don't know if it was the protien or the grain components previous foods that she was allergic to. Or she may have multiple food allergies. At some point, it might be worth tinkering, but for now, I'm being a total food fascist. She gets her food and nothing else, except the odd plain potato treat. The only problem is that the food makes her smell like hickory smoked french fries. Yummy, but it makes me hungry. It's also kind of low in calories and fat, which is a little concerning. She's eating almost 2x what she did on other foods, and the output is about 2x as much, as well. But those things weighed against the fact that she's not licking her feet? No contest. I had resigned myself to the possibility that she was just a nut case and was licking from OCD. . .. I would have thought she was out of it by now. She was. As soon as the stitches came out, she was out of the cone. I put her back in it last Monday, because she'd started chewing her feet again. That was due to a fungal infection, which is now under control. She hasn't touched her feet since I took the cone off on Thursday. She also has a yeast infection in her ears. I'm betting it's because she's on antibiotics. She's hopefully got just one more week of them left, at which point, the ear infection should quickly clear up.
